Isuzu receives Indi 4.0 Award from the Ministry of Industry

Heaptalk, Jakarta — Isuzu Astra Motor Indonesia (IAMI) has received the Indi 4.0 Award in the Smart Factory category from the Ministry of Industry. This recognition was achieved through the creation and optimization of industrial technology, both in general and specifically in the realm of Industry 4.0.

As an official brand holder, manufacturer, and distributor of Isuzu vehicles in Indonesia, the company demonstrates its supports for government programs aligned with the automotive industry. One of these initiatives is Making Indonesia 4.0, which aims to advance the entire business ecosystem in Indonesia and position the country among the Top 10 Global Economies by 2030.

Under the program, industry players are encouraged to enhance productivity through digital transformation across all business sectors, including the automotive industry, which is one of the seven targeted business sectors by the government. Yusak Kristian, President Director of PT Isuzu Astra Motor Indonesia (IAMI), explained that this achievement signifies that the company’s vision of becoming a World Class Manufacturer is beginning to materialize, which will further enhance the company’s performance moving forward.

“This award reinforces IAMI’s journey to become a National Lighthouse and affirms that IAMI’s digitalization efforts are recognized by the state, bringing us closer to our vision of becoming a World Class Manufacturer,” Yusak stated in a written statement on Monday (10/07).

With this award, Isuzu is recognized as a company participating in the Making Indonesia 4.0 program from the Ministry of Industry and is one of 60 companies in Indonesia with an Indi 4.0 score greater than 3.0. Furthermore, the company is the first in Indonesia to receive an Indi 4.0 Certificate in the commercial vehicle (CV) sector.
